BASTEDO/BESTEDER Family in AL
Posted by: Annette McLane (ID *****9849) Date: July 05, 2003 at 11:10:11
  of 164

Looking for ancestry of John BESTEDER, b. in NJ about 1803. The surname has many varient spellings in census records for NJ. In Alabama, John is "Besteder". He is believed derived from a BASTEDO/BESTEDO family in Middlesex or Morris County, NJ. This from cencus records: in his 20's, John Besteder married "Aliza" (b. SC). He obtained land in Marengo Co., AL, where he became a planter of some means (value in 1860 was $10,000/$20,000), living there for at least 30 years before his death(?). John and Aliza had at least 3 or 4 children, Mary M., Westley A., Josaphine, and Fallon (?) The Besteder name is still found in Marengo Co., AL. Any information on the origins of this family--where they came from, John's parents and siblings, his wife's family, etc.-- will be greatly appreciated.
